When Katherine Johnson’s genius in analytical geometry was needed, she was transferred from West Computing to the Space Task Group, an all white, male group of engineers and mathematicians charged with plotting the trajectory to put John Glenn into orbit in 1962 and astronauts on the moon in 1969. The girls’ work environment mirrored the social injustices of the 1950s and 1960s with Jim Crow laws mandating separate bathrooms, drinking fountains, and lunch rooms for the computers working in West Computing. The girls in the “East Area Computing Unit” were Caucasians who worked in a different building, a world away in so many ways. The girls worked together in the “West Area Computing Unit” and individually were known as computers. Beginning in the 1940s, a group of African American female mathematicians, working in the West Area Computing Unit at NASA’s Langley Lab in Virginia, crunched books full of complicated numbers.
